#83e208 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#83e208 is composed of 51.4% red, 88.6%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.5%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 86.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 45.9%. #83e208 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#07c500.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

#83e208 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#83e208 has RGB values of R:131, G:226,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 8643080.

Shades and Tints of #83e208
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a1201 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#83e208
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757674 is the less saturated color, while #83e208 is the most saturated one.
